kicker external taskbar transparency issues with upgrade to KDE 3.5.10

Bug #263130 reported by Lucas Cardoso
6
Affects Status Importance Assigned to Milestone
kdebase (Ubuntu)
Fix Released
Low
Andreas Wenning

Bug Description

After upgrading to Ubuntu versions of KDE 3.5.10, I noticed a quite prominent kicker bug: When using multiple desktop wallpapers, kicker's external taskbar does not update the transparent background in areas where no window widgets are placed (that is, the rightmost area when the taskbar is not full, and the whole taskbar when no windows are open). The only way to get an update is by clicking the "hide" arrow at the rightmost spot and then bring the bar back--which will still contain a small graphic glitch on the very edge, where you will be able to see the leftmost part of the wallpaper.

I also noticed a change in the way the applet configuration arrow is shown, not sure if it's related.

Pictures:

Desktop at startup, notice that since there has been no desktop switch yet, it shows up instead as a gray space:
http://img184.imageshack.us/img184/5200/kickerbug2yp4.jpg

This is what happens when switching to another desktop (after "refreshing" the taskbar by hiding it and unhiding it):
http://img510.imageshack.us/img510/2818/kickerbug4hl9.jpg
http://img510.imageshack.us/img510/148/kickerbug5yu1.jpg

Here's the related glitch when "refreshing" the taskbar. Notice the lower-right corner...
http://img505.imageshack.us/img505/2577/kickerbug8iw4.jpg
http://img205.imageshack.us/img205/9861/kickerbug7ub0.jpg

As you can see the black area from the leftmost area has been "moved" to the right.

And here's the other change I noticed... which I'm not sure about its relationship with this bug.
http://img507.imageshack.us/img507/8827/kickerbug6ad7.jpg

That arrow there used to look different.

Tags: kde3.5.10
Revision history for this message
Andreas Wenning (andreas-wenning) wrote :

Hi Lucas

I've found what I believe to be the fix in upstream kde svn. I've build the package with the fix included:
http://awen.dk/packages/kde3.5.10/kdebase/

Please test and report back if this fixes the problem.

Changed in kdebase:
assignee: nobody → andreas-wenning
status: New → In Progress
Revision history for this message
Lucas Cardoso (lcardoso) wrote :

Fix confirmed. Transparency works correctly now.

Thanks for the heads up :)

Changed in kdebase:
assignee: andreas-wenning → nobody
status: In Progress → Fix Committed
Revision history for this message
Andreas Wenning (andreas-wenning) wrote :

To clarify: Fix committed means that it has been uploaded to ubuntu and not just my personal PPA; I'm changing it back to in progress.

Changed in kdebase:
assignee: nobody → andreas-wenning
status: Fix Committed → In Progress
Changed in kdebase:
importance: Undecided → Low
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package kdebase - 4:3.5.10-0ubuntu1~hardy2

---------------
kdebase (4:3.5.10-0ubuntu1~hardy2) hardy-backports; urgency=low

  * Added kubuntu_99_upstream_r854109.diff:
    - This fixes layout (multiline) problems in systemtray.
  * Added kubuntu_100_upstream_r850417.diff:
    - This fixes missing taskbar background updates when using
      transparency (LP: #263130)

 -- Andreas Wenning <email address hidden> Tue, 16 Sep 2008 20:20:04 +0200

Changed in kdebase:
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.